Description
As a Maintainability Engineer you will be supporting the ILS Manager and Principal Maintainability Engineer in implementation of:
Maintainability programmes
Prediction and modelling of Maintainability aspects of design systems
Assistance in planning, implementation of performance demonstrations and trials
Liaison with design teams, customer representatives and suppliers.
Principal Accountabilities:
- Supporting the ILS Manager and Principal Maintainability Engineer in implementation of maintainability programmes
- Generation of technical reports and design review presentations
- Maintainability prediction and modelling of complex mechanical, electrical and electronic systems
- Compilation of Maintainability Predictions, inputs to FMECA (Failure Modes Effects & Criticality Analysis), Ground Support and Test Equipment detail, Packaging, Handling, HAZMAT identification, Parts/Spares detailing, Maintenance Reports and Repair Costs calculations.
Qualifications and Technical skills:
- HND/HNC equivalent or higher in Electronic/Mechanical/Aeronautical Engineering or similar HNC qualified with suitable experience in an Aerospace related field or Armed Forces experience as a senior maintainer/manager.
- Maintainability Predictions
- MSG3/RCM (Reliability Centred Maintenance) Analysis
- Requirements Appraisal/Securing Compliance
- Proven capability in Maintainability analyses (Predictions and modelling), Training Needs Analysis and Human Factors Integration.
- Proven capability in Access and ILS related software tools eg Reliability Workbench
- Familiarity with MIL-STD- & 472, DEF STAN 00-250.
- Experience of aircraft systems and maintenance, particularly airframe, fuel (engines) would be an advantage.
